摘要

Among the bulk polymers used in coatings and adhesive, conventional polyurethanes have proved to be one of the most difficult to produce entirely from biomaterials. There are plenty of polyurethanes on the market with bio-based polyols that are reacted with isocyanates to form the polymer. But, to make a green isocyanate - which is formed by treating amines with phosgene - would be a massive scientific challenge.
